ARMET, also known as MANF, was initially identified as a protein containing an arginine-rich region that was highly mutated in a variety of tumors. More recently it was identified as a mesencephalic astrocyte-derived neurotrophic factor with selectivity for dopaminergic neurons, similar to glial cell line-derived neurotrophic factor (GDNF) and CDNF. In rat brain slices, ARMET enhanced nigral gamma-aminobutyric acid release. Like GDNF and CDNF, ARMET has selective neuroprotective activity for dopaminergic neurons suggesting that it may be indicated for the treatment of Parkinson's disease. Expression of ARMET has also been shown to be induced during ER stress, suggesting that it may play a role in protein quality control during ER stress.Synonyms: Arginine-rich protein, MANF, Mesencephalic astrocyte-derived neurotrophic factor
